Some miscellaneous Indiana court records.


Vigo County, Indiana.

Circuit Court Civic Order Book 2, 1825-1831 April term 1829.
FamilySearch film 8055429 image 472 p 329
The Grand Jury returned the following indictments...
State of Indiana vs William Slaven, assault & battery with intent to murder

image 481 p 345 April term 1829
State of Indiana vs. William Slaven, assault and battery
Capias ordered and that bail be taken in the sum of five hundred dollars and continued
(Capias: a writ ordering the arrest of a named person.)

image 490 p 364 September term 1829
State of Indiana vs William Slaven, indicted assault & battery with intent to kill
Ordered that the cause be continued and that alias capias issue returnable to the next term of this court.
Alias capias warrants are issued in felony cases when the defendant fails to appear for court.

image 518 p 420 May term 1830
State of Indiana vs William Slaven, indicted assault & battery with intent to murder
Ordered that this case be continued to the next term of court and that a pluries capias issue returnable to the next term of this court.
(pluries capias: A third or subsequent writ of attachment, issued when previous writs have proved ineffectual.)

image 542-3 p 468-9 November term 1830
State of Indiana vs William Slaven, indicted assault & battery with intent to murder
Ordered that this cause be continued and that the Sheriff of Posey County shall cause at the next term of this court why he has not returned the writ of capias directed to him against the defendant and that a pluries capias issue.

image 568 p 520 May term 1831
State of Indiana vs William Slaven, indicted assault & battery with intent to murder
The prosecuting attorney says he will no further prosecute this indictment; it is therefore considered that the defendant go thereof without day.
("go thereof without day" indicates that there was no further date when the defendant was required to appear.)
